Is 107 712 148 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 107 712 148 is about 10 378.446.

Thus, the square root of 107 712 148 is not an integer, and therefore 107 712 148 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 107 712 148?

The square of a number (here 107 712 148) is the result of the product of this number (107 712 148) by itself (i.e., 107 712 148 × 107 712 148); the square of 107 712 148 is sometimes called "raising 107 712 148 to the power 2", or "107 712 148 squared".

The square of 107 712 148 is 11 601 906 826 773 904 because 107 712 148 × 107 712 148 = 107 712 1482 = 11 601 906 826 773 904.

As a consequence, 107 712 148 is the square root of 11 601 906 826 773 904.
